What Does a Car Locksmith Do?

Cars are an essential part of the modern world. They enable us to travel from point A to point B faster and more efficiently. Sometimes, they fail in most inconvenient of ways. A car locksmith is able to help.

A professional NYC automotive Locksmith will have tools that can assist you in getting back into your car if you are locked out. These tools are usually inserted between the weather stripping of the door and the frame.

Key Replacement

Locksmiths are typically called upon to replace, reprogram or repair car keys, remotes, and FOBs. The process of programming keys or FOBs typically involves connecting the device to the OBD port of your vehicle (commonly located beneath the dashboard). It then transfers data between the system and the vehicle to allow you to access your vehicle and start it. The remote or key may need different technology depending on the make and model of your vehicle. Locksmiths make use of special hardware and software to program all models.

Car keys are constructed with many moving parts, and are prone to breaking or becoming stuck in locks. If your key is damaged from the lock, you can call your locksmith local to help you take it out. You might be tempted to attempt it yourself, but it's not a wise choice. You could damage your ignition cylinder or lock if you attempt to remove the key by hand.

If your old key is damaged or missing, you may need an entirely new one. Getting a copy from your dealer can be costly, but the locksmith is a cheaper alternative. You can usually provide the locksmith with the year and make of your vehicle and proof that you own the vehicle to get the key duplicated.

Some car owners use keys to start and open their vehicle, instead of a traditional key. It's okay to do this, however it is difficult to replace in the event that you lose your key fob. A locksmith can help with this, Locksmith Car Keys because they can create an exact replica of your current key fob, and then program it to work with your vehicle.

Nissan-New.pngYou can also try using the key fob duplication machine, which is available at some hardware stores. These machines are easy to use, and they can be a cheaper alternative to going to an auto dealer. However, they are not always accurate and might not be able to duplicate all types of key fobs.

Lockout Service

You'll require an expert locksmith if you happen to lock yourself out of your vehicle or apartment. A lot of these firms have staff members who are familiar with all types of cars and their locks. They can also make replacement keys if needed. Before you call, be sure to have all the essential information you need. This includes the year, model and year of your vehicle as along with the VIN number. You'll need evidence that you have ownership of the vehicle, such as your driver's license or vehicle registration.

It's a hassle to be locked out of your car. More stressful is the situation if you are in a rush to get to a location. The right auto locksmith will simplify the process. They can unlock your vehicle quickly and cost-effectively. They can also change the ignition key, create "regular keys" or reprogram your (if you have a transponder) key.

Another service that car locksmiths provide is replacing damaged locks. They can install various types of locks, like padlocks or deadbolts. Based on your requirements, they can install alarms and security systems. Auto locksmiths are professionals that can do a great job.

It might be tempting if you are in a rush and want to speedily open your vehicle yourself. This could be dangerous and your car could suffer more damage. It's not worth taking the risk. You may also damage your possessions or suffer injuries. Find a licensed, qualified car locksmith with a proven track-record.

Some companies offer 24/7 car lockout service. These companies will respond to your call no matter if it's in late at night or first thing on Sunday morning. A technician will be sent to your location to unlock your car and restore your peace of mind. Some of these companies even offer mobile services so that they can visit you if your car has a breakdown or is stuck in a hazardous area.

Key Fob Replacement

Change key fobs is among of the most common locksmith services offered by car. These are the small remotes which unlock your doors and may also begin the car. Like any piece of modern technology, they are prone to break or stop working at any moment. The most frequent issue is usually an inoperable battery. It is easily fixed by replacing it with a brand new one. Other issues could require more extensive repairs, or even replacement.

A locksmith in your car can reprogram your new key fob to work with your vehicle. If you've lost it or the fob was damaged by heat, water or other environmental factors, this is a great idea. Certain companies manufacture aftermarket fobs that function just as the ones your car locksmith prices uk came with, but most locksmiths in the auto industry prefer OEM units. They are designed to exact specifications and sizes and will be a perfect fit for your vehicle model.

Many people turn to a dealership for help when they're having issues with their key fob, but this isn't always a good option. The good news is that the majority of locksmiths in the automotive industry have the tools needed to program an entirely new key fob at significantly less than what you'd pay at a dealership.

Some replacement fobs come with a mechanical key hidden inside the fob, which can be used to open the door and start the engine in case of emergency. This is particularly useful if your fob's batteries fail or if you accidentally put your keys in the car.

Car Door Lock Repair

When car locks go wrong it can be stressful and risky. Car locksmiths are trained to identify and fix issues quickly, without causing more damage. The best choice in an emergency is to call your roadside assistance provider or insurance company to locate the nearest locksmith. They can provide the list of approved auto locksmiths. It might seem more cost-effective to try and solve the issue by yourself, but you could end up spending more in the long run in the event that you fail to resolve the problem.

If your power door lock isn't working, it is probably time to replace the actuator. The cost of a new one is about $50. It comes with a second key and retainer clips. The locksmith car Keys must remove the door panel, and then disconnect the door lock cylinder to install the new actuator. They may need to remove the locking system, which requires a special tool.

The keyhole on a manual doorlock could become jammed by dirt and rust. A reputable locksmith can spray the mechanism with lubricant and help get it unjammed. If the problem persists you can use a flathead tool to pry the lock out. This method is applicable to both manual and electronic locks, but it requires an extensive amount of effort and might not be worth it in the long run.

Another way to test your locks is to turn the posts and buttons inside using the key, press the remote unlock button and then move them around. Any movement that doesn't lead to the door opening or closing suggests an obstruction. A proper movement, however, can be a sign of worn and disconnected components. A professional locksmith will rekey the lock cylinder, which will ensure that the original key will still be used to unlock the lock. The locksmith will need to remove the old cylinder from the door and disassemble it. They'll need to cut keys that match the transponder that was used previously. This process is typically more time-consuming than repairing a damaged lock.
